House, which was originally scheduled for Friday nights, has been rescheduled for Sunday nights to follow Homeland.
The show returns to TEN with a double episode 9:35pm Sunday February 5 in Melbourne, Adelaide and Perth.

“Parents”
House and his team treat a teenage boy who requires a bone marrow transplant, and discover a disturbing family secret; House also schemes to get rid of his ankle monitor to go to a boxing match.
“Dead And Buried”
A 14-year-old girl admitted for emotional issues shows worsening physical symptoms. However, House is obsessed with the case of a deceased four-year-old and will go to any lengths to solve it.
